The beta model is defined as
f(d,theta)=E0+Emax B(delta1,delta2)(d/scal)^delta1(1-d/scal)^delta2
where
B(delta1,delta2)=(delta1+delta2)^(delta1+delta2)/(delta1^delta1 delta2^delta2).

The beta model is intended to capture non-monotone
dose-response relationships and is more flexible than the quadratic model.
The kernel of the beta model
function consists of the kernel of the density function of a beta
distribution on the interval [0,scal]. The parameter
scal is not estimated but needs to be set to a value
larger than the maximum dose via the argument scal
.
